Took the rig out to 7-Mile ORV park in Spokane, WA to see what kinda capability I have stock. Couple successful hill ascents later and I found myself here. Open diffs, highway tires, and thick sand dug me into a pretty bad rut. A bit of excavation and a few mighty tugs from my buddy in his silverado got me freed. My buddy's truck ended up worse-for-wear, didn't have a nice sturdy tow hitch to hook up to, and the cross member he fitted it to wasn't quite as strong as my front tow hooks...
